Acrobat 3000 (AC3000) Spring Arm as support arm for iLED operating lights, TRUMPF Medizinsysteme GmbH + Co KG 82178 Puch
FDA device recall Z-2311-2012 · posted 2012-09-05 · Terminated
Recall details
- Recalling firm
- Trumpf Medical Systems, Inc.
- Reason for recall
- Cracks can arise on the welded seam on the rear joint.
- Action taken
- TRUMPF sent an Urgent Safety Information letter dated February 4, 2012, to all affected customers. The letter identified the product, the problem, and the action to be taken by the customer. Customers were instructed to ensure that within their organization, all users of the affected product be informed about the Urgent Safety Information. If affected product was further distributed, customers should forward a copy of the information or inform the necessary parties. Customers were asked to confirm receipt of the Urgent Safety Information by completing and returning the confirmation of receipt. For questions regarding this recall call 888-474-9359.
